Description

Coconut Oil Fatty Acids, Glycerin, Phthalic Anhydride Polymer is a specialized alkyd resin intermediate produced by the condensation polymerization of key raw materials. This compound is valued for its ability to impart flexibility, adhesion, and specific solubility characteristics to final polymer formulations. It is primarily sought by manufacturers in the coatings, adhesives, and specialty chemical industries for developing high-performance products.

Application

  • As a key polymeric building block in the formulation of alkyd resins for industrial and decorative coatings.
  • Modifier for adhesives and sealants to enhance flexibility and substrate adhesion.
  • Intermediate in the production of plasticizers and polymeric additives.
  • Raw material for manufacturing specialty esters and polymeric surfactants.
  • Component in printing ink vehicles to adjust rheology and film properties.
  • Used in research and development for novel biobased polymer synthesis.

Basic Information

Product Name Coconut Oil Fatty Acids, Glycerin, Phthalic Anhydride Polymer
CAS No. 67746-02-5
Molecular Formula Contact for details
Molecular Weight Contact for details
Synonyms Alkyd resin, coconut oil modified; Poly(glycerol phthalate-co-coconut fatty acid ester); Phthalic anhydride-glycerol-coconut oil fatty acid copolymer; Coconut fatty acid alkyd; Glycerol phthalate coconut oil polymer; Alkyd resin based on coconut oil; Coconut oil modified glycerol phthalate resin

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area away from strong acids, organic solvents, and sources of ignition. Due to its polymeric nature and sensitivity to oxidation, prolonged exposure to elevated temperatures and air should be avoided. Recommended storage temperature is between 15°C and 25°C.

Specification

Item Specification
Appearance Viscous liquid to semi-solid
Color (Gardner) ≤ 6
Acid Value (mg KOH/g) 5 - 15
Viscosity (Gardner-Holdt) Z2 - Z5
Solids Content (%) ≥ 98.0
Identification (IR) Conforms
